What Exactly Is a Loft Style Apartment?
Apartments come in many varieties. Among these, the so-called ‘Loft Apartment’ usually features higher ceilings, and larger windows, and frequently includes industrial design elements.

How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Bothell?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Bothell Studio Apartments | $1,941 | $1,677 | $2,509 |
Bothell 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,247 | $980 | $5,146 |
Bothell 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,854 | $1,695 | $7,087 |
Bothell 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,943 | $2,192 | $5,060 |
Bothell 4 Bedroom Apartments | $3,100 | $2,444 | $9,630 |

What Are Walk Score®, Transit Score®, and Bike Score® Ratings?
- Walk Score® measures the walkability of any address.
- Transit Score® measures access to public transit.
- Bike Score® measures the bikeability of any address.
